The history of family medicine as a specialty
Author(s)Chris Mazzolini, Logan Lutton
How family medicine has changed thru the years And why family medicine has changed.
Advertisement
Medical Economics recently sat down with Timothy Hoff, PhD, who wrote the new book, “Searching for the Family Doctor: Primary Care on the Brink.”
